Skip to content

/AWS1/CL_VPSPOLICYTEMPLATEITEM

Contains details about a policy template

This data type is used as a response parameter for the ListPolicyTemplates operation.

CONSTRUCTOR

IMPORTING

Required arguments:

iv_policystoreid TYPE /AWS1/VPSPOLICYSTOREID /AWS1/VPSPOLICYSTOREID

The unique identifier of the policy store that contains the template.

iv_policytemplateid TYPE /AWS1/VPSPOLICYTEMPLATEID /AWS1/VPSPOLICYTEMPLATEID

The unique identifier of the policy template.

iv_createddate TYPE /AWS1/VPSTIMESTAMPFORMAT /AWS1/VPSTIMESTAMPFORMAT

The date and time that the policy template was created.

iv_lastupdateddate TYPE /AWS1/VPSTIMESTAMPFORMAT /AWS1/VPSTIMESTAMPFORMAT

The date and time that the policy template was most recently updated.

Optional arguments:

iv_description TYPE /AWS1/VPSPOLICYTEMPLATEDESC /AWS1/VPSPOLICYTEMPLATEDESC

The description attached to the policy template.

iv_name TYPE /AWS1/VPSPOLICYTEMPLATENAME /AWS1/VPSPOLICYTEMPLATENAME

The name of the policy template, if one was assigned when the policy template was created or last updated.


Queryable Attributes

policyStoreId

The unique identifier of the policy store that contains the template.

Accessible with the following methods

Method Description
GET_POLICYSTOREID() Getter for POLICYSTOREID, with configurable default
ASK_POLICYSTOREID() Getter for POLICYSTOREID w/ exceptions if field has no value
HAS_POLICYSTOREID() Determine if POLICYSTOREID has a value

policyTemplateId

The unique identifier of the policy template.

Accessible with the following methods

Method Description
GET_POLICYTEMPLATEID() Getter for POLICYTEMPLATEID, with configurable default
ASK_POLICYTEMPLATEID() Getter for POLICYTEMPLATEID w/ exceptions if field has no va
HAS_POLICYTEMPLATEID() Determine if POLICYTEMPLATEID has a value

description

The description attached to the policy template.

Accessible with the following methods

Method Description
GET_DESCRIPTION() Getter for DESCRIPTION, with configurable default
ASK_DESCRIPTION() Getter for DESCRIPTION w/ exceptions if field has no value
HAS_DESCRIPTION() Determine if DESCRIPTION has a value

createdDate

The date and time that the policy template was created.

Accessible with the following methods

Method Description
GET_CREATEDDATE() Getter for CREATEDDATE, with configurable default
ASK_CREATEDDATE() Getter for CREATEDDATE w/ exceptions if field has no value
HAS_CREATEDDATE() Determine if CREATEDDATE has a value

lastUpdatedDate

The date and time that the policy template was most recently updated.

Accessible with the following methods

Method Description
GET_LASTUPDATEDDATE() Getter for LASTUPDATEDDATE, with configurable default
ASK_LASTUPDATEDDATE() Getter for LASTUPDATEDDATE w/ exceptions if field has no val
HAS_LASTUPDATEDDATE() Determine if LASTUPDATEDDATE has a value

name

The name of the policy template, if one was assigned when the policy template was created or last updated.

Accessible with the following methods

Method Description
GET_NAME() Getter for NAME, with configurable default
ASK_NAME() Getter for NAME w/ exceptions if field has no value
HAS_NAME() Determine if NAME has a value

Public Local Types In This Class

Internal table types, representing arrays and maps of this class, are defined as local types:

TT_POLICYTEMPLATESLIST

TYPES TT_POLICYTEMPLATESLIST TYPE STANDARD TABLE OF REF TO /AWS1/CL_VPSPOLICYTEMPLATEITEM WITH DEFAULT KEY
.